What is Invisalign and How Does It Work?
Invisalign is an innovative orthodontic treatment that uses a series of custom-made, clear plastic aligners to shift your teeth into their proper positions. Instead of tightening wires to pull teeth into place, this system relies on precise, computer-generated trays that apply gentle pressure to specific teeth at specific times.
The process begins with advanced 3D imaging technology. Your orthodontist takes a digital scan of your mouth, mapping out the exact movements your teeth need to make. This software allows you to see a digital preview of your future smile before you even wear your first aligner.
Based on this 3D plan, a laboratory creates a sequence of clear trays specifically for your mouth. You wear each set of aligners for about one to two weeks before swapping them out for the next set in the series. Step by step, your teeth gradually move into alignment.
These aligners are made from a patented thermoplastic material called SmartTrack. It is engineered for comfort and precision, offering a massive advantage over the sharp edges and poking wires associated with traditional braces.

Benefits of Choosing Invisalign Over Traditional Braces
When weighing your orthodontic options, Invisalign offers several compelling advantages over standard metal braces.
Unmatched Aesthetics
The most obvious benefit is the clear appearance of the aligners. Because the trays are transparent and sit snugly against your teeth, they are virtually invisible. Most people will not even notice you are undergoing orthodontic treatment. This makes the system incredibly popular for adults in professional settings and self-conscious teens who want to avoid the “metal mouth” look.
Superior Comfort
Traditional braces use metal brackets glued to your teeth and stiff wires that can irritate your cheeks and gums. Invisalign implant trays feature smooth, polished edges. While you might feel some temporary pressure when you switch to a new set of trays—a sign that the system is working—you completely bypass the cuts and scrapes common with metal hardware.
Ultimate Convenience
Because the aligners are completely removable, you do not have to change your diet. With metal braces, you must avoid sticky, chewy, or hard foods that could break a bracket. With clear aligners, you simply pop out your trays, eat whatever you want, brush your teeth, and put the trays back in. Flossing and brushing also remain easy, allowing you to maintain excellent oral hygiene throughout your treatment.
Who is a Good Candidate for Invisalign?
In its early days, Invisalign aligners was only recommended for minor cosmetic adjustments. Today, thanks to advancements in the technology, it can correct a wide variety of mild to complex dental issues.
You are likely a great candidate if you experience any of the following:
Crowding: When your jaw lacks the space to accommodate all your teeth, causing them to overlap and twist.
Gaps: Unwanted spaces between teeth that can trap food and cause gum irritation.
Overbites: When your upper front teeth overlap significantly with your lower front teeth.
Underbites: When your lower front teeth sit in front of your upper teeth.
Crossbites: When some upper teeth sit inside the lower teeth rather than outside them.
Age rarely restricts candidacy. Both teens and adults can see fantastic results. However, the most important factor in determining if you are a good candidate is your willingness to comply with the rules. Because the trays are removable, the success of the treatment relies entirely on your dedication. You must commit to wearing the aligners for 20 to 22 hours every single day, taking them out only to eat, drink anything other than water, and brush your teeth.
What to Expect During the Invisalign Treatment Process
Understanding the roadmap of your treatment helps eliminate any anxiety about the process. Here is what your journey to a straighter smile will look like.
The Initial Consultation
Your journey begins with a detailed evaluation. Your doctor will examine your teeth, take digital scans or physical impressions, and capture X-rays and photographs. They will discuss your goals and determine if clear aligners can achieve the results you want.
Aligner Fitting and Attachments
Once your custom trays arrive from the lab, you will return to the office for your fitting. During this appointment, your doctor will ensure the first set fits perfectly. They may also apply small, tooth-colored bumps called “attachments” to certain teeth. These act like tiny handles, giving the aligners something to grip onto to execute more complex tooth movements.
Progress Check-ups
You will handle most of the work at home simply by wearing your trays and changing them as directed. Every six to eight weeks, you will visit your doctor for a quick progress check. They will verify your teeth are moving according to the plan and hand you your next batches of aligners.
Maintenance Tips for Success
To keep your treatment on track:
Wash your hands before handling your aligners.
Clean your trays gently using a soft toothbrush and clear, unscented antibacterial soap.
Never use hot water to rinse them, as the heat can warp the plastic.
Always store your aligners in their protective case when eating. Wrapping them in a napkin often leads to accidentally throwing them away.

How to Find the Best Invisalign Orthodontists Near Me
The technology behind the clear trays is impressive, but the skill of the doctor designing your treatment plan matters just as much. You want an expert who understands the complex biomechanics of tooth movement.
Start by researching providers in your area. Look for doctors who specifically highlight their experience with clear aligners. Check online reviews to see what previous patients say about the office environment, the friendliness of the staff, and the final results.
Pay attention to credentials and continuous education. Doctors who perform a high volume of these cases often receive specific tier designations from the manufacturer, which can be an indicator of their experience level.
Finally, use the initial consultation as an interview. Do you feel rushed, or does the doctor take time to explain the 3D rendering of your teeth? A great provider will answer all your questions thoroughly, transparently discuss costs, and make you feel entirely confident in their care.

Cost of Invisalign: What You Need to Know
A common question for anyone considering orthodontic work is about the financial investment. The cost of clear aligners varies from person to person because every mouth is different.
Several factors influence your total bill. The most significant is the complexity of your case. A minor crowding issue that takes six months to fix will cost less than a severe bite alignment problem requiring two years of treatment. The number of aligners you need and the length of your treatment directly dictate the price.
Fortunately, making this investment in your smile is more accessible than ever. If you have dental insurance that covers orthodontic treatment, it will likely cover a portion of your clear aligners just as it would traditional braces. You can also use funds from a Flexible Spending Account (FSA) or Health Savings Account (HSA) to pay for your care using pre-tax dollars.

Tips for Maintaining Your Smile After Invisalign
The day you take out your final set of aligners is a day to celebrate. However, your orthodontic journey does not entirely end there. Teeth have a natural tendency to shift back to their original positions, a process known as relapse.
To protect your new smile, you must wear a retainer. Initially, your doctor will likely instruct you to wear your custom-made retainer full-time, just like you wore your active aligners. After a few months, you can usually transition to wearing it only at night while you sleep.
Maintaining excellent oral hygiene remains critical. Continue dental brushing twice a day and flossing daily. Straight teeth are actually much easier to keep clean because there are fewer tight, overlapping spaces where plaque can hide.
Do not forget to keep up with your regular dental check-ups and cleanings. Your dentist and orthodontist will monitor your bite to ensure your teeth stay perfectly aligned and healthy for decades to come.
